5 Ways To Discover Apartment Or Condos For Rent

Finding the best home or house to rent can be difficult and hard. You can be taking on many others for a quality system in a prime place.

The secret, real estate brokers state, is to prepare ahead. Frequently occupants will wait until the last minute to try to find another apartment or condo. However, when renters are in a rush they tend to take apartments they do not really want.

Here are a couple of tips for finding the very best rental houses and apartment or condos in your area.

1. Start your search 60 days before your move

The best rentals, in terms of cost, place and features, go earlier in the month, so do not wait till midmonth to search for a new location to live, Macon states. It's finest to start searching 60 days prior to you need to move, especially if you are searching for a rental home where there isn't as much offered.

The 3rd and 2nd weekends of the month tend to be the busiest. There will be less competitors and the finest homes will still be offered if you begin your search the first weekend of the month.

2. Look for rental listings online

About 90% of tenants will begin home hunting on the web. If you're moving to a new city, home leasing sites won't inform you enough about communities and the local amenities of each, such as public transportation or grocery shops.

3. Utilize a real estate broker

Real estate brokers are offered to help occupants discover properties totally free of charge. The key is to discover a broker who specializes in rental residential or commercial properties, not home sales.

If you're searching in locations where there is generally tight competitors for apartments, you'll wish to talk with a variety of realty agents prior to committing to one due to the fact that various agents have various relationships with different buildings. Ensure you are talking with an agent who has access to the apartment in neighborhoods where you wish to lease.

4. Do not be fooled by frauds

Be aware of online frauds, particularly advertisements on Craigslist that need you to supply your credit card to pay a deposit fee to be shown the house. Nobody needs to need a deposit to reveal you an apartment or condo.

Be mindful if you are leasing an apartment or condo directly from a private individual because you will be providing an overall complete stranger your Social Security number and your bank account info, and they will likely run a credit check on you. It's more secure to work with a licensed and bonded real estate broker.

5. Consider roomies

If you're thinking about sharing a home, ensure you know who your roommates will be and consider asking the proprietor for different leases. If you have a joint lease and the lease is $2,000 a month, you are responsible for the entire quantity if your roomies don't pay their share, Macon states. If you have a different lease, you're accountable only for your portion of the lease.

Don't hesitate to request for referrals if you do not understand your roommates. You can likewise utilize social networks - LinkedIn, Facebook And Twitter - to find out more about them.
